ATNEL tech-forum https://forum.atnel.pl/ |
|
dla potomnych RS485 https://forum.atnel.pl/topic23753.html |
Strona 1 z 1 |
Autor: | akenes [ 4 maja 2021, o 09:45 ] |
Tytuł: | dla potomnych RS485 |
Nie żebym miał się czymś chwalić ale kilka słów o problemach w komunikacji RS485. Od dawien dawna posiadałem zestaw 1.05a, natomiast kilka tygodni temu zakupiłem drugi, również 1.05a. W domu robię oświetlenie LED na diodach WS, położyłem skrętkę i zamierzam to uruchomić na RS485. Ale żeby najpierw ogarnąć łączność, i pyszne smaczki postanowiłem skorzystać z możliwości jakie daje MK Bootloader 3 i zrobić listę urządzeń. Wczoraj pół wieczora , gdzie tam, cały wieczór straciłem na próbach uruchomienia poprawnej łączności z drugim zestawem. Przeczytałem oczywiście instrukcję do zestawu ATB, o tym jak połączyć przewody gdy jeden z zestawów ma robić za programator a drugi za odbiornik nasłuchujący bootloaderem.... i w kołko to samo... zestaw nasłuchujący odpowiadał raz może na 5 razy, a wgrywanie wsadu po rs485 udawało się może raz na 50 razy. Ciągle były Timeouty. W końcu mnie oświeciło i wziąłem do ręki przejściówkę ATB-USB-RS232 , przestawiłem zworki i użyłem jej jako programatora po RS485. I... za każdym razem sukces w zestawie odbiorczym. No to ten zestaw który robił na początku za programator przezbroiłem na odbiornik, podłączam się do niego przejściówką ATB-USB-RS232 i zonk, nie chce działać, znów Timeouty. No to wyjąłem z przejściówki ATB-USB-RS232 scalaczek SN75176 i przełożyłem do mojego starego zestawu. Ustawiłem go jako programator, połączyłem z nowym zestawem i ..... SUKCES za każdym razem. Tak sobie myślę, że pewnie uwaliłem tego scalaka kiedyś , zworkując linie RX TX gdy coś miałem podpięte. Ostrzeżenia Mirka w instrukcji do zestawu jednak nie w kij dmuchał )) A już nie wspomnę jak mnie irytowało gdy czytałem tu na forum opis któregoś z kolegów który właśnie taką listę urządzeń stworzył i wszystko mu pięknie śmigało. Załącząłem w pewnej chwili wątpić w to czy potrafię ze zrozumieniem podpiąć kabelek do goldpina |
Autor: | mirekk36 [ 4 maja 2021, o 10:33 ] |
Tytuł: | Re: dla potomnych RS485 |
No ale to są właśnie uroki, smaczki i niewątpliwe "przyjemności" rwania sobie włosów z głowy przy uruchamianiu czegoś nowego. A gdzie drwa rąbią tam iskry czasem ze scalaków lecą ... sam ostatnio do poradnika o czujnikach ciśnienia - podłączyłem niechcący zasilanie odwrotnie do BME280. Zorientowałem się o tym gdy zobaczyłem dym i nagle doznałem niezłego poparzenia w palec którym trzymałem tego maluszka ... No to po ptakach ! pomyślałem widząc siwy dym wprawdzie szybko rozłączyłem no ale jak taki dym poleciał to czujnik musiał zdechnąć ... a tu ZONK ... nie wiem jak ale czujnik nie dość że przeżył to jeszcze skubany daje dobre pomiary Z kolei nie dalej jak dzisiaj - robię do kolejnego poradnika komunikację z nowym urządzeniem HID które zbudowałem - ze strony PC (delphi) oczywiście na podstawie Orangebooka - no i nie działa i nie działa ... już wszystko sprawdzam ... aż pomyślałem - co to za KUŹWA gostek napisał tą książkę - w której się chwali, że mu to działa w jednym tam ćwiczeniu o "Dance Mat" a mi nie działa hahahahaha .... No ale po raz kolejny zabrałem się za to od nowa - no i okazało się że znalazłem babola .... ot skleroza nie boli - toż zapomniał ja nastawić funkcje FN_READ i FN_WRITE w usbconfig.h no to nie dziwota że nie działało. Teraz już zaczyna śmigać i mogę lecieć dalej z programowaniem. Więc nie jesteś sam w swoich bojach panie kochany chyba KAŻDY tak miewa. |
Strona 1 z 1 | Strefa czasowa: UTC + 1 |
Powered by phpBB® Forum Software © phpBB Group https://www.phpbb.com/ |